Record and development:
Online poker surfaced in the belated 1990s as a result of breakthroughs in technology additionally the net. The very first online poker space, globe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a little but enthusiastic neighborhood. But was at early 2000s that online High Stake Poker practiced exponential growth, primarily as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
Popularity and Accessibility:
One of many known reasons for the immense interest in on-line poker is its ease of access. People can log in to their most favorite online poker platforms whenever you want, from everywhere, utilizing their computers or cellular devices. This convenience has drawn a diverse player base, ranging from recreational people to experts, adding to the rapid growth of online poker.
Features of Online Poker:
Internet poker provides a number of advantages over old-fashioned brick-and-mortar casinos. Firstly, it gives a larger range of online game choices, including different poker variants and stakes, catering into choices and spending plans of all of the kinds of people. Furthermore, on-line poker areas tend to be open 24/7, eliminating the constraints of physical casino operating hours. In addition, on the web systems often offer attractive bonuses, respect programs, as well as the power to play numerous tables at the same time, improving the general video gaming experience.
Challenges and Regulation:
Whilst online poker business thrives, it faces challenges in the shape of regulation and security concerns. Governments worldwide have implemented varying degrees of regulation to guard people and give a wide berth to deceptive activities. Also, internet poker platforms need sturdy protection actions to guard players' private and economic information, ensuring a safe playing environment.
Financial and Personal Influence:
The rise of internet poker has received an important economic impact globally. Online poker systems create considerable income through rake fees, event entry charges, and advertising. This income has generated work creation and investments within the video gaming business. More over, internet poker features added to a rise in taxation revenue for governing bodies where it's controlled, promoting general public services.
